Abstract
Fast transient response is the most important requirement of the voltage regulator modules (VRMs). This paper presents a new control scheme for multiphase buck converter circuits used in VRMs. This control scheme has fast dynamic response and better load rejection characteristics compared to the conventional control scheme of interleaved VRMs. The simulation results show improvement in the transient performance
